所有类都从Object类中继承了equals方法,Object类中equals方法源代码:
public boolean equals(Object obj){
return this = obj;
}
equals()方法与“==”有所不同:
equals()方法指向的是方法区的对象实际内容,“==”指向的是堆区的对象。
参考博文:Java Object类的equals()方法
public boolean equals(Object obj){
return this = obj;
}
equals()方法指向的是方法区的对象实际内容,“==”指向的是堆区的对象。
参考博文:Java Object类的equals()方法